Output e66093a641d77b6a9abd1272dea06e96bee73eaecf42ad99bef91c59a6abf1d2:1

value
2955330
script pubkey
OP_0 OP_PUSHBYTES_20 79d705279255d70e14eadcb34bb7c7c22dca3bde
address
bc1q08ts2fuj2htsu982mje5hd78cgku5w77ah77cp
transaction
e66093a641d77b6a9abd1272dea06e96bee73eaecf42ad99bef91c59a6abf1d2
confirmations
152132
spent
true